The postcode HP12 3EL is located in Buckinghamshire It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. HP12 3EL is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

HP12 3EL is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.4 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of HP12 3EL as Multicultural metropolitans > Challenged Asian terraces > Asian terraces and flats.

The closest road name to HP12 3EL is Whitelands Road which is centered 23 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Whitelands Road and is 158 m away. The closest railway station is High Wycombe Rail Station, 2.08 km away.

The closest primary school to HP12 3EL (for ages 11 and under) is Oakridge School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Requires improvement on May 3,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Unity College. The last OFSTED inspection on September 28, 2017 rated this school as Good

The nearest takeaway food is available from Red Hot Pizza / China Garden and is 233 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on September 23,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 104.2 Mbps and an average upload speed of 28.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 91.5%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.3 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for HP12 3EL is covered by the Thames Valley police force association and Buckinghamsh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
